Sat 897345836460882

decimal
179469.836460882
degree
0°179469′45″836460882‴
percentile
42.7307541641887%
name
hmmbiuflqpz
cycle
0
epoch
0
period
89
block
179469
offset
836460882
timestamp
rarity
common